Since there aren't many tours to talk about at this time, what are some best bands you have seen live?

Testament - I believe this was in 2016. This actually beat the record for the loudest show I had ever been to. It surpassed Motorhead, to deafening heights. There is a few thousand seater that I go to, that redid their PA system after Hurricane Sandy blasted its way through. The venues PA system came back louder and beefier. Metal bands sound amazing here. Testament were no exception. I stood in front of Alex, just in awe of his playing. I was front row and just took it all in. This was a tour of all older material. I never saw them back in the day, so this was great as a long time fan.

Gwar - This was a more recent show, with the current vocalist. I only pick this one over any show with Oderus, because the experience was more fun for me. I was front row at this show for all of the blood and dismemberment. This was the first tour after the death of Oderus, so the theme of the show was bringing Oderus back to life, through a time travel portal (that brought everyone through except Oderus). A great set of old material and new. Brent Purgason, of Cannibas Corpse was on guitars, which was an extremely cool to spot to be standing at a show. Not much else needs to be said, if you know anything about Gwar. They always put on a great show.

Municipal Waste - I believe this was in the 2014 timeframe. It was a few thousand seater and a good chunk of them had this insane pit. I never partake, I would rather watch the band. For a bunch of musicians stoned out of their minds, this had to be one of the highest energy performances I have ever seen a band play. At one point the singer called for there to be five or six lines of constant people being passed up to the front during the next song. The entire place erupted into complete chaos. A lot of fun to be in the middle of the chaos and see the band play with such ferocity.

I saw Iron Maiden at Jiffy Lube Live in 2019 and they were amazing, especially considering Bruce had just recovered from throat cancer of all things. He still sang amazingly well and was jumping all around with a flamethrower and all sorts of cool shit. The theatrics were amazing and the sound was equally awesome. Even the band that opened for them, The Raven Age, was pretty good too, albeit with less of a good sound.
